Emilia-Romagna Region - Public Transports
Emilia-Romagna Region is responsible for the elaboration of the
General Integrated Transport Plan ( P.R.I.T.) and guide-lines
for the development of inter-modality of regional and local services.
Co-ordination of the regional and local authorities (Communes and
Provinces) on transport policies is guaranteed by institutional
agreements - the so called Accordi di Programma - that
identify mutual commitments about quantity and quality of services,
subsidies for operation and investments (in infrastructures and
vehicles), urban mobility, customer care, safety, traffic and environment.
While the P.R.I.T. is updated every 10 years, the local
plans have to be negotiated every 3 years.
The Regional Public Transport Agency, set up in march 2001,
is directly responsible for the regulation of railway services and
coordination of related investments, monitoring of local transport
plan implementation with particular regards to customer care, mobility
management measures and results (focusing on quality, environment,
safety and traffic).
Agency mission in details:
- concession of regional railway lines operation
- negotiation of service contract on regional and local railway
services
- management of operation and investment subsidies
- providing guide-lines for the local planning of bus services
- financing of local Transport and Mobility Agencies by negotiating
contracts on services and investments every three years (Accordi
di Programma)
- monitoring of the quantity and the quality of railway and bus
services as well as of the overall local mobility quality.
